**Financial Crime Analyst in Bengaluru** Mid-level professionals with experience in financial crime operations/investigations (Fraud, AML, KYC, FCOI) are sought to join our dynamic team in Bengaluru. This role involves reviewing Chase UK banking customers across Line of Business (LOB) escalations, KYC, and FCOI queues, documenting risk decisions aligned with regulatory standards. Analyze complex cases using multiple information sources, produce clear recommendations, escalate key risks, and manage workload to meet service level agreements (SLAs). Ideal candidates possess strong analytical, communication, and time management skills, with a proven ability to make independent decisions using sound judgment and risk-based thinking. Previous experience in financial crime operations and a solid understanding of relevant technological tools are required. Job Summary (3 sentences)
As a Financial Crime Analyst within the Financial Crime team supporting Chase UK, you review customers across LOB Escalations, KYC, and FCOI queues and document well-supported risk decisions. You analyze complex cases using multiple information sources, produce clear recommendations, and escalate key risks to management in a timely manner. You manage workload to meet SLAs while partnering with stakeholders and contributing to continuous improvement initiatives.

Job Responsibilities 

  • Perform customer reviews, document analysis, and record outcomes aligned to corporate and local regulatory standards.
  • Analyze escalations raised by internal stakeholders and synthesize information from multiple sources.
  • Produce clear, concise summary recommendations and case write-ups to support decision outcomes.
  • Support relationship reviews for customers escalated due to financial crime concerns.
  • Draft escalation narratives tailored to senior audiences when required.
  • Investigate cases within agreed processes and document outcomes with strong clarity and rationale.
  • Escalate key risks and issues to management promptly with actionable context.
  • Manage personal workload to progress cases within SLAs and prioritize competing items.
  • Build stakeholder partnerships across the firm and provide candid feedback when needed.
  • Identify process improvement opportunities and support change and technology initiatives as an SME.
  • Participate in knowledge-sharing and calibration calls to ensure consistent outcomes and SLA adherence.
  • Required qualifications, capabilities, and skills 

  • Demonstrate experience in Fraud, AML, KYC, FCOI, or financial crime operations/investigations.
  • Apply strong analytical, research, and critical thinking skills to reach well-supported decisions.
  • Communicate effectively in writing and verbally, including upward stakeholder management.
  • Write clear, concise case narratives and recommendations with strong attention to detail.
  • Manage time effectively under pressure, meeting fixed deadlines and SLA requirements.
  • Execute process improvements and provide SME support on process and technology initiatives.
  • Make independent decisions using sound judgment and risk-based thinking.
